Red Bull optimistic after free practice

The mood is good at Red Bull after the first day of testing in Abu Dhabi. Christian Horner's men were in great form at the Yas Marina circuit on Friday, including Max Verstappen's best time in Free Practice 1 in the morning.

According to the Dutchman, this performance comes as a surprise. “The car seems to be working very well, better than we expected, a bit like in Brazil. I felt comfortable from the first laps, and it usually ends with a good result on Friday, He explains.

 

The difference between the best should come down to tire management according to him. We are comfortable with that. I expect Abu Dhabi to be a race that will be decided by tire consumption, I hope we benefit from that”, positive Max Verstappen.

In ambush, his teammate Daniel Ricciardo wants to complete his Red Bull adventure in the best possible way. Before joining Renault in 2019, the Australian will compete in his 100th GP with the Austrian team and could well aim for victory.

 

“Since my victory in Monaco, I absolutely want to have an ideal weekend and I know that Abu Dhabi is my last chance with Red Bull. I want more. »

The wearer of No. 3 set the second and then the third times. “The hyper soft tires are more grippy on the front axle while the ultra and super soft tires have more grip at the rear. »

Red Bull's strong point according to Daniel Ricciardo, speed over the long term. « We seem fast during the long stints, even if we still need to find some performance on the short stints. »
